It is all gloom and disappointment and sorrow
deickemeyer7 January 2016
This story of drunkenness, murder, unjust accusation and various other somewhat exciting events shows a girl as the one who suffers principally and her lot is indeed hard. After being subjected to all the distress depicted in the earlier portions of the film fate follows her to the last and her lover dies in her arms after the villain, because he helped to convict a murderer, throws him into the river, bound to a log. The impression this film makes is not pleasant. There is a feeling of horror after seeing it, which lingers long. It is all gloom and disappointment and sorrow. The operator or the printer or both ought to be more careful of the mechanical work. The tones are not well maintained. And this poor mechanical workmanship is made all the more important by the fact that the acting of the Imp pictures is above the ordinary and most of them tell good stories. - The Moving Picture World, April 22, 1911
